Web28 feb. 2024 · Using lui/leur = him or her/them (French Indirect Object Pronouns) In French, just like in English, to avoid repeating words placed after a preposition that follows a verb (which are called indirect objects), you use indirect object pronouns. Try … WebPronominal verbs (les verbs pronominaux) are verbs that take a reflexive pronoun (me, te, se, nous, vous, se). The reflexive pronoun always comes before the verb and corresponds to the subject.
